Let me introduce you to Marvin and Milo.  They may seem like an ordinary cat and dog but we have used them at Whissendine, for many years, to help us to understand science - particularly physics!

 

I have chosen 4 of Marvin and Milo's fun and fascinating experiments, all linked to our work, this term, on 'States of Matter' - that's solids, liquids, gases, precipitation, condensation, evaporation... check out the Knowledge Organiser for more!

 

I would like you to have some science fun at home - you can do one or all four of them - and then report back to me how you got on.  Was Mum a super scientist? Did dad get carried away with it all and go out to buy himself a white lab coat? Did you have some family science fun together?  It is up to you how you report this back to me.  You can take some photos, make me a small video , write up some notes -  share yours, and your families, learning with me.
